What's Happening?
Qualcomm has announced the launch of two new artificial intelligence chips, AI200 and AI250, aimed at the data center market. These chips are designed to enhance memory capacity and AI inference capabilities, with commercial availability set for 2026
and 2027. The announcement marks Qualcomm's strategic move to diversify beyond its traditional smartphone market, as it seeks to compete with industry leaders like Nvidia and Advanced Micro Devices. The company's stock surged nearly 15% following the announcement, reflecting strong market enthusiasm for its AI initiatives. Qualcomm's new chips are expected to lower the total cost of ownership for enterprises and support common AI frameworks and tools. The company also introduced accelerator cards and racks based on these new chips.

What's Next?
Qualcomm's entry into the AI data center market is expected to intensify competition with established players like Nvidia. The company's collaboration with AI startup Humain to deploy 200 megawatts of AI racks in Saudi Arabia by 2026 highlights its commitment to expanding its global footprint. As Qualcomm continues to develop its AI roadmap, focusing on inference performance and energy efficiency, it will be crucial to monitor how these efforts translate into market share gains and influence the broader AI ecosystem.
